This book unveils the truth of our ultimate destiny in God. There is a great deal of misinformation in the Body of Christ concerning the believer’s purpose and destiny in God’s ultimate intentions. Dr. Varner strips away the religious veneer clouding the issues. With a stroke of the prophetic pen he draws a dramatic picture of the greatness of your place in Jesus. With one shake of the spiritual kaleidoscope Dr. Varner brings clear and prophetic focus to the Biblical drama surrounding God’s divine purposes for the church. You will be stunned by the significant part you play in God’s plan for the end of days.
